topBeing built for tough action doesn’t mean the µ TOUGH-8000 and µ TOUGH-6000 skimp on image quality. Boasting 12 and 10 Megapixels respectively, both provide ample resolution to faithfully record scenes to the smallest detail. Furthermore, each model incorporates clever features that ensure spectacular results. Capable of recognising up to 16 faces, Advanced Face Detection Technology guarantees that human subjects are always perfectly focused and exposed. Additionally the µ TOUGH-6000 also has a handy Smile Shot feature which enables the camera to take the picture as soon as the person smiles. Meanwhile, Shadow Adjustment Technology assures that optimal contrast levels are attained across the entire image. Shooting ease is also enhanced through the inclusion of Intelligent Auto Mode: it identifies the scene being framed and automatically adjusts camera settings to one of five commonly-used scenes. In addition, Beauty Mode smoothes the skin of subjects while the shot is being taken, making for more even and brilliant skin tones.
The resilient µ TOUGH-8000 and µ TOUGH-6000 are a natural choice for anyone looking for a camera that can keep up with their own active lifestyle. Waterproof, shockproof and freezeproof, they hit stores in mid-January and early February 2009 respectively.
